Transaction 156db207a69e3ea7ff85ff1fceea21f877d44bae8be512921a3489cd052b65e9
1 Input
2 Outputs
- 156db207a69e3ea7ff85ff1fceea21f877d44bae8be512921a3489cd052b65e9:0
- 156db207a69e3ea7ff85ff1fceea21f877d44bae8be512921a3489cd052b65e9:1
value 255000
address 34wRcNu3wyxfWmP2AubYf3F65iCmEuZdVN
value 79142130
address 3GZJP33D3LEDAnxuhp4a4uqSpSojFKuREX